Use of hormonal contraceptive pills may be associated with increased risk of breast cancer
While the 20% increased risk among women using contemporary formulations of oral contraceptives is similar to that initially reported among users of older formulations, an editorial noted, the finding that breast cancer risk continues to be elevated for five years or more should be regarded as preliminary because the increase in risk would not have remained significant after adjustment.

Recurrence of estrogen-receptor-positive early-stage breast cancer after endocrine therapy associated with TN status at diagnosis
Patients with stage T1 disease had a 13% risk of distant recurrence with no nodal involvement, 20% risk with involvement of one to three nodes, and 34% risk with involvement of four to nine nodes.

Menopausal hormone therapy linked to breast cancer risk
An individual patient-level meta-analysis found that risk for breast cancer increased steadily with duration of use for all types of menopausal hormone therapy except vaginal estrogen and that risk was higher with estrogen-progestogen than estrogen-only formulations.

ACS changes breast cancer screening recommendations for women at average risk
Based on the available evidence, the American Cancer Society recommends that women who are at average risk of breast cancer should have regular screening mammography beginning at age 45.
